Lt. Dewayne Smith, the Memphis police supervisor who was on the scene during Tyre Nichols' beating death, retired with benefits before he was fired.

Lt. DeWayne Smith was identified Friday in records obtained by media outlets as the officer that officials said earlier this month had retired before his termination hearing.

The attorney for Nichols' family said the department should not have let Smith "cowardly sidestep the consequences of his actions" and retire after 25 years. Seven other Memphis officers were fired after Nichols died following a traffic stop on Jan. 7 and five of them are charged with second-degree murder. Smith is not charged in Nichols' death.

The decertification documents against Lt. Smith reveal additional details about his actions that night.
